JTA - A tweet by President Donald Trump on Friday night, with Houston recovering from Hurricane Harvey and his sister Irma set to ravage Florida, is renewing hope among Jewish groups that have long advocated for emergency assistance to houses of worship.
Churches in Texas should be entitled to reimbursement from FEMA Relief Funds for helping victims of Hurricane Harvey (just like others), Trump said on Twitter, referring to the Federal Emergency Management Agency.
Attempts in the past two Congresses to extend FEMA protections to houses of worship had broad bipartisan support, but were stymied by the Obama administrations concerns over church-state separation.
Jewish groups advocating for the change welcomed the change in tone.
Nathan Diament, the Washington director of the Orthodox Union, which has led advocacy for the policy change, said that Trump needed only to order the change; there was no statute barring emergency funds from going to houses of worship. Still, he said, including houses of worship as beneficiaries of FEMA assistance should be written into law.....
